Review of Tango: Our Dance (1988) by Adley T — 06 Mar 2009
I like it because it is not talking about tango fantasia but what a life in tango is about. It is what psychiatrist prescribes instead of anti-depressant, it is to make your partner dance well more than showing how you dance well, it is to know the history of it when you dance, it is to know the music (not the lyric ?) when you dance in it.
Very down to earth, nothing fancy, only the young kids got fancy and lost the substance...
